Etymology

[edit]

From dialectal Proto-Slavic *žuxъva, from *žuxati +‎ *-ъva.

Pronunciation

[edit]
  • IPA(key): /ˈʐux.fa/
  • Audio:(file)
  • Rhymes: -uxfa
  • Syllabification: żuch‧wa

Noun

[edit]

żuchwa f

  1. (anatomy) the mandible of a jawed vertebrate
